The opening sequence of ‘Mr and Mrs Smith’ starts of very simple, they are both sitting down on chairs in a room and talking to someone about how their marriage is not working out. The first name that comes on in the beginning is the executive producers of the film which is ‘Regency Enterprises’ which is 33 seconds in. The second is 55 seconds in which says ‘A New Regency Production’. 1.33 minutes in it says a ‘Summit Entertainment Production’. 1.33 minutes in it says ‘A Weed Road Pictures Production’ and then finally it says the title which is Mr and Mrs Smith. The first beginning of the film foreshadows that there will be problems between both the couples because they need a marriage guidance counselling.
